Man convicted on charges in UD student’s death sentenced, ordered to pay funeral costs

DAYTON — A New Lebanon man convicted on vehicular homicide charges stemming from the death of a University of Dayton student in 2020 was sentenced to some jail time and ordered to cover funeral and burial costs.

Kyler Carlile, 31, was sentenced in Montgomery County Common Pleas Court after he pleaded no contest to a charge of vehicular homicide and guilty to a misdemeanor charge of leaving the scene of an accident earlier this month. Carlile was the driver of a truck that transported Michael Currin, 19, of Cincinnati when Currin either fell or jumped from the truck, causing his fatal injury.

On Monday afternoon, Carlile was sentenced to five years of community control sanctions, 30 days in the Montgomery County Jail on weekends, and will have his driver’s license suspended for two years, according to the Montgomery County Prosecutor’s Office.

Carlile was also ordered to pay over $22,600 in restitution to cover Currin’s funeral and burial costs, a prosecutor’s office spokesperson said.

Previously, prosecutors said Carlile saw Currin walking on Wayne Avenue in the early morning hours of September, 20, 2020. Investigators said Currin, a first-year student at UD, was walking to pick up a late-night food order when he accepted the ride and was in the back of the pickup truck.

During that drive, Currin either fell or jumped out of the truck. When Carlile noticed Currin was no longer in the bed of the truck, he drove back the way he came and saw the injured Currin lying in the street but Carlile didn’t stop to help or call 911, prosecutors said.

Currin died from his injuries two days later.
